35. ee area that is well ventilated Avoid areas where heat electrical noise and electromagnetic fields are generated You will also need it placed near a grounded power outlet Be sure to read the Rack and Server Pre cautions in the next section 6 3 Preparing for Setup The box your chassis was shipped in should include two sets of rail assemblies two rail mounting brackets and the mounting screws you will need to install the system into the rack Please read this section in its entirety before you begin the installation procedure Choosing a Setup Location e Leave enough clearance in front of the rack to enable you to open the front door completely 25 inches e Leave approximately 30 inches of clearance in the back of the rack to allow for sufficient airflow and ease in servicing e This chassis is for installation only in a Restricted Access Location dedicated equipment rooms service closets and similar environments 6 1 SC747TG Chassis Manual Warnings and Precautions Rack Precautions Ensure that the leveling jacks on the bottom of the rack are fully extended to the floor with the full weight of the rack resting on them e In single rack installation stabilizers should be attached to the rack e In multiple rack installations the racks should be coupled together e Always make sure the rack is stable before extending a component from the rack e You should extend only one component at a time extend

42. ing two or more si multaneously may cause the rack to become unstable General Server Precautions e Review the electrical and general safety precautions that came with the com ponents you are adding to your chassis Determine the placement of each component in the rack before you install the rails Install the heaviest server components on the bottom of the rack first and then work up e Use a regulating uninterruptible power supply UPS to protect the server from power surges voltage spikes and to keep your system operating in case of a power failure Allow the hot plug hard drives and power supply modules to cool before touch ing them 6 2 SC747TG Chassis Manual e Always keep the rack s front door and all panels and components on the servers closed when not servicing to maintain proper cooling Rack Mounting Considerations and Ambient Operating Temperature If installed in a closed or multi unit rack assembly the ambient operating tempera ture of the rack environment may be greater than the ambient temperature of the room Therefore consideration should be given to installing the equipment in an environment compatible with the manufacturer s maximum rated ambient tempera ture TMRA Reduced Airflow Equipment should be mounted into a rack so that the amount of airflow required for safe operation is not compromised Mechanical Loading Equipment should be mounted into a rack so that a hazardous co

58. r is off An illuminated green light indicates that the power supply is operating Replacing the Power Supply With a redundant power supply the system automatically switches to the second power supply if the first should fail Replacing the Power Supply 1 Power down the chassis and unplug the power cord If your chassis includes a redundant power supply at least two power modules you can leave the server running and remove only one power supply Push the release tab on the back of the power supply as illustrated Pull the power supply out using the handle provided Replace the failed power module with the same model Push the new power supply module into the power bay until you hear a click Plug the AC power cord back into the module and power up the server 5 27 SC747TG Chassis Manual Notes 5 28 SC747TG Chassis Manual Chapter 6 Rack Installation 6 1 Overview This chapter provides instuctions for installing your system into a rack environment Following the instructions in the order given should enable you to install the system within a minimal amount of time 6 2 Unpacking the System You should inspect the box the chassis was shipped in and note if it was damaged in any way If the chassis itself shows damage you should file a damage claim with the carrier who delivered it Decide on a suitable location for the rack unit that will hold your chassis It should be situated in a clean dust fr

68. stem Interface 4 1 Overview There are several LEDs on the control panel as well as others on the drive carriers to keep you constantly informed of the overall status of the system as well as the activity and health of specific components SC747TG models have two buttons on the chassis a control panel a power on off button and a reset button This chapter explains the meanings of all LED indicators and the appropriate response you may need to take Figure 4 1 Front LEDs 4 1 SC747TG Chassis Manual 4 2 Control Panel Buttons There are two push buttons located on the front of the chassis These are power on off button and a reset button Power The main power switch is used to apply or remove power from the power supply to the server system Turning off system power with this button removes the main power but keeps standby power supplied to the system Therefore you must unplug system before servicing Reset The reset button is used to reboot the system 4 3 Control Panel LEDs The control panel located on the front of the SC747TG chassis has five LEDs These LEDs provide you with critical information related to different parts of the system This section explains what each LED indicates when illuminated and any corrective action you may need to take UO e HDD Indicates IDE channel activity SAS SATA drive and or DVD ROM drive activity when flashing A io _ m e NIC1 Indicates network acti

71. vity on GLAN1 when flashing 4 2 SC747TG Chassis Manual Overheat Fan Fail When this LED flashes it indicates a fan failure When continuously on not flashing it indicates an overheat condition which may be caused by cables obstructing the airflow in the system or the ambient room temperature being too warm Check the routing of the cables and make sure all fans are present and operating normally You should also check to make sure that the chassis covers are installed Finally verify that the heatsinks are installed properly This LED will remain flashing or on as long as the overheat condition exists e Power Fail Indicates a power failure to the system s power supply units 4 3 SC747TG Chassis Manual 4 4 Drive Carrier LEDs Your chassis uses SAS SATA drives SAS SATA Drives Each SAS SATA drive carrier has two LEDs e Green Each Serial ATA drive carrier has a green LED When illuminated this green LED on the front of the SATA drive carrier indicates drive activity A con nection to the SATA backplane enables this LED to blink on and off when that particular drive is being accessed e Red The red LED indicates a SAS SATA drive failure If one of the SAS SATA drives fail you should be notified by your system management software 4 4 Chapter 5 Chassis Setup and Maintenance Chapter 5 Chassis Setup and Maintenance 5 1 Overview This chapter covers the steps required to install components and perfor
